Seattle experiences second driest March in decades

2019 has been a year for weather records.

After earning the titles of snowiest February, coldest February since 1989, and hottest winter day, Seattle experienced its second driest March in decades.

Sea-Tac Airport recorded 1.37 inches of rain for the month. The record was set in 1965 when 0.57 inches of rain fell. The third driest March was in 1979 with 1.55 inches; 1973 is in fourth place with 1.62 inches.

Even though Seattle experienced three record-breaking days of warm weather earlier this month, we won't come close to the warmest March on record. The average high temperature so far this month is 56.3 degrees, which is 3.9 degrees warmer than usual; however, it's still in ninth place.
